Title: Touched by the road toll - NSW
Project Description: In Australia there are five deaths on our roads every day. ??????Touched by the road toll?????? is an online social network for all those affected by road trauma. Behind every fatality there are a thousand stories. This online sanctuary provides a space where people can tell their story, create compelling tributes, find support and understanding from an online community, and ultimately heal.
Target Media: Web, Mobile, TV, Virtual Worlds, Locative Mapping, Physical World
